Structural fo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the stability of a building’s underlying support system. This process typically includes identifying issues such as cracks, uneven floors, or shifting walls that indicate foundational problems. Rep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ization techniques designed to strengthen and secure the foundation, helping to prevent further damage and maintain the structural integrity of the property.
These services help address common foundation problems ca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or settling over time. When a foundation shifts or sinks, it can lead to structural issues, including cracked walls, misaligned doors and windows, or uneven flooring. Repair solutions aim to correct these issues by stabilizing the foundation, which can mitigate the risk of more extensive damage and costly repairs in the future.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for structural fo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method used. For example, min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while extensive underpinning could reach $7,000 or more.
Scope of Repair - Repair costs vary based on the size and severity of the foundation issues. Smaller repairs, such as crack sealing, generally fall within $1,500 to $3,000, whereas major foundation stabilization can exceed $10,000 in some cases.
Material and Method - The choice of repair materials and techniques influences the overall cost. Pier and beam repairs may cost between $3,000 and $8,000, while slab foundation fixes can range from $4,000 to over $10,000 depending on complexity.
Location Factors - Costs can fluctuate based on local labor rates and regional building conditions. In areas like Belle Plaine, MN, foundation repair services typically fall within the general national range, with some projects costing more due to specific site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Signs can include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window or door frames.
How do professionals typically repair foundation problems? Rep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or slabjacking, depending on the severity and type of foundation issue.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ed based on crack size, location, and progression.
How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
